Reduced the size, reduced the quality, increased the price. Whiskas report that research done by Waltham Petcare Science Institute says 85g is the right size for cats. Waltham Petcare Science Institute is owned by Mars Incorporated, Whiskas is owned by Mars Incorporated.

Been feeding for over 10 years and pouches have just decreased in size and ingredient list changed with changes being hidden on bottom of box. The recommendation used to be 3 pouches a day for a 5kg cat, now 4-4.5 a day for same size cat. They haven’t changed the price so cost per day has gone up by 50%. The contents also now smell like a cheap cat food. Avoid.
